With many years of experience to her credit, Emily Gallo has excelled as a lauded novelist and retired educator whose lifelong advocacy for underrepresented communities has greatly informed her most recent published works. Beginning with her 2015 book "Venice Beach: A Novel," she has penned a number of acclaimed fictional stories, including dramas, character studies and mysteries. Her growing portfolio of publications includes "The Columbarium" in 2015, "Kate and Ruby" in 2016, "Roads Not Taken" in 2017, "Murder at the Columbarium" in 2018 and "The Last Resort" in 2020. Notably, Ms. Gallo's work has not only garnered rave reviews by a worldwide audience, but have been released as audiobooks narrated by the author herself.

Prior to her career as an independent writer, Ms. Gallo worked for more than 15 years as an elementary school teacher operating out of the Northampton, Massachusetts, and Davis, California, regions while balancing her responsibilities as a loving wife and the mother of two wonderful children. Since 2009, she has additionally served as the editor for The Derelict Voice, a multiple-volume publication producing the results of a writing group that she organized for the local homeless population. Moreover, she flourished as a screenwriter and an independent production consultant between 2009 and 2013. Before embarking on her professional path, Ms. Gallo pursued an education at Clark University, earning a Bachelor of Arts in English in 1967.

About Marquis Who's Who®
Since 1899, when A. N. Marquis printed the First Edition of Who's Who in America®, Marquis Who's Who® has chronicled the lives of the most accomplished individuals and innovators from every significant field of endeavor, including politics, business, medicine, law, education, art, religion and entertainment. Today, Who's Who in America® remains an essential biographical source for thousands of researchers, journalists, librarians and executive search firms around the world. Marquis® now publishes many Who's Who titles, including Who's Who in America®, Who's Who in the World®, Who's Who in American Law®, Who's Who in Medicine and Healthcare®, Who's Who in Science and Engineering®, and Who's Who in Asia®.
